The other day I reported on a problem trying to connect with RDP to two of my Win10 machines. While GreyFox was leading me to the pond to drink, I observed that both of those machines had network status as "Public." Not knowing how that could be, I changed it to Private, and my problem was solved -- for the time being.

Now, I have observed that something in the Windows Update process is resetting my network status to Public -- on those two machines, plus one other. I know not why or what.
